SEASON ONE - 2005
Rose - 2005
The End of the World - 5,000,000,000,000
The Unquiet Dead - 1860
Aliens of London - 2006
World War Three - 2006
Dalek - 2012
The Long Game - 200,000
Father's Day - 1987
The Empty Child - 1941
The Doctor Dances - 1941
Boom Town - 2006
Bad Wolf - 200,100
The Parting of the Ways - 200,100

SEASON 2 - 2006
New Earth - 5,000,000,000,023
Tooth and Claw - 1873
School Reunion - 2007
The Girl In The Fireplace - 1727-1758
Rise of the Cybermen - Alternate 2007
The Age of Steel - Alternate 2007
The Idiot's Lantern - 1953
The Impossible Planet - Some point in the future (4000s)
The Satan Pit - Some point in the future (4000s)
Love & Monsters - 2007
Fear Her - 2010
Army of Ghosts - 2007
Doomsday - 2007

SEASON THREE - 2007
Smith & Jones - 2008
The Shakespeare Code - 1599
Gridlock - 5,000,000,000,053
Daleks in Manhattan - 1930
Evolution of the Daleks - 1930
The Lazarus Experiment - 2008
42 - I don't know, but it's in the future!
Human Nature - 1913
The Family of Blood - 1913
Blink - 2007
Utopia - 100 Trillion
The Sound of Drums - 2008
Last of the Time Lords - 2008

SEASON FOUR - 2008
Partners of Crime - 2009
The Fires of Pompeii - 79
Planet of the Ood - 4126
The Sontaran Stratagem - 2009
The Poison Sky - 2009
The Doctor's Daughter - Future!
The Unicorn and the Wasp - 1926
Silence in the Library - 51st Century
Forest of the Dead - 51st Century
Midnight - Future!
Turn Left - Alternate 2007-2009
The Stolen Earth - 2009
Journey's End - 2010

SPECIALS - 2009
The Next Doctor - 1851
Planet of the Dead - I don't know. I would just say recent.
The Waters of Mars - 2059
The End of Time - I want to say 2010

SEASON FIVE - 2010
The Eleventh Hour - 2008
The Beast Below - 29th Century
Victory of the Daleks - WWII
The Time of Angels - Future!
Flesh & Stone - Future!
The Vampires of Venice - 1580
Amy's Choice - Technically, it was all a dream, so all times! (because they were on the TARDIS...)
The Hungry Earth - 2020
Cold Blood - 2020
Vincent & The Doctor - 1890
The Lodger - 2010
The Pandorica Opens - 102
The Big Bang - Alternate 1996 (would it have a date? I mean the universe was being destroyed... Maybe I should just say 2010, because that's when it's all better?)

SEASON SIX - 2011
The Impossible Astronaut - 1969
Day of the Moon - 1969
The Curse of the Black Spot - 1699
The Doctor's Wife - It's in a bubble universe, so I don't actually know...
The Rebel Flesh - 22nd Century
The Almost People - 22nd Century
A Good Man Goes To War - Future!
Let's Kill Hitler - 1938
Night Terrors - 2011?
The Girl Who Waited - Future!
The God Complex - Was it 2011? I think the hotel was plucking people up from random planets, but not from differing points of time.
Closing Time - 2011
The Wedding of River Song - April 22nd 2011, 5:02pm. Or ALL OF TIME ITSELF!!!


So after all of that, I've concluded that there have been no episodes of Doctor Who set in BC, and none set in the recent past at the time of recording (so while at this point, Rose is set 6 years ago, at the time, it was in the present). It's called Touched By An Angel. It's about a man whose wife died in a car crash in 2003. In 2011, he gets a letter that was meant to be given to him on a certain day, and it's in his handwriting. On the way home, he's then stalked by a Weeping Angel, and finally sent back to 1994. He opens the letter to find a lot of money, and a note written by himself with a list of things to do, ending with "remember, you can save her!". It then follows through his life (both past and future him), and stuff. The Doctor, Amy & Rory are all involved as well, of course. They have to follow him to make sure he doesn't change the past (which is what the Angels want to happen. These are special Weeping Angels, that feed on paradoxes).
